No offense, but I can't help frowning when I see someone trackstanding on a road bike, knowing how much easier it is on a fixie. The benefits for me, besides the fun, is the durability, the minimal maintenance required and the reduced need for using the brakes, saving the rim and the brake shoes. The traction feedback and balance correction abilities has saved me from many crashes on icey roads. I feel that my fixie makes me want to go faster, while my freewheel bike tempts me into coasting.
nilo2209 2 years ago
But that's just me. Like I said elsewhere, it's also a matter of taste. I only see the benefits of a road bike in the mountains or if you ride straight ahead for long time. I commute in a big flat city so for me the direct drive and the lack of variable gears was a great relief.
nilo2209 2 years ago
